Dolebury Warren
Description
Located not too far from the city center, this is a Site of Special Scientific Interest and also designated as a Scheduled Ancient Monument - serious history buffs will love it (the less esoteric can ignore all that and just enjoy a great countryside walk here). Dolebury fort is an exceptional example of an Iron Age hill fort and has an adjacent Celtic field system, approximately 2000 years old and there is also a medieval rabbit warren - a definite contender for 'Strangest Attraction of the Year Award'! The best time of year to see the wildflowers and 29 species of butterflies on this limestone heath is from late May to August.
